I recently picked up a IIGS and the keyboard it came with had alps orange switches. Well several of the keys didn't respond well (maybe about 6 keys) sprayed the switches out with deoxit and finally after several dozen pushes they started responding pretty consistantly. However the "4" key would not respond whatsoever. I desoldered the key switch and took it apart. I can't really find anything faulty with this, but granted I know nothing about this switch. If I hook an ohmmeter to the terminals I will get a close circuit when i press the middle plastic part, but trying to get it to work with the switch just seems a lost cause. Didn't know if someone had run into this before or not, or worse case, if someone knew a source for a replacement switch.
